Research Associate/Fellow
Applications are invited for the above post, funded by the MRC, to undertake
mathematical analysis of single ligand-receptor interactions. The research
project, under the supervision of Professor S J Hill and Professor F G Ball,
concerns the development and implementation of compound Poisson based models
for analysing photon counting histograms arising from single ligand-receptor
interactions.
Candidates should have, or expect to obtain shortly, a PhD in statistics.
Experience of statistical model development and fitting, and strong computing
skills are essential, as is enthusiasm for engaging with the biophysical
aspects of the project.
